Transaction 56076f0016e2c255c29bdbc64d44110950930f103353f4a0125ab7ef54a417aa
1 Input
2 Outputs
- 56076f0016e2c255c29bdbc64d44110950930f103353f4a0125ab7ef54a417aa:0
- 56076f0016e2c255c29bdbc64d44110950930f103353f4a0125ab7ef54a417aa:1
value 101556189
address 325UrWqcBzN4Q33bTJQRPiiRjQPvrcA7H4
value 13544141
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n